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Ironton). They really took it to the Fairland Dragons for the full four quarters, racking up a 70-13 victory. The contest was pretty much decided by the half, when the score had already reached 49-7.
Ironton's success was the result of a balanced attack that saw several players step up, but Easton Caudill led the charge by rushing for 82 yards and a pair of scores. The bulk of those rushing yards came from one huge play: a run that gained an incredible 73 yards. Mason Wheeler was in the mix as well, providing Ironton with one TD.
Special teams also played a big role in the game for Ironton, adding 22 points to the final score. The biggest highlight from special teams (and perhaps the team as a whole) came courtesy of Caleb Jacobs, who ran a punt back for a touchdown.
The win made it two in a row for Ironton and bumps their season record up to 7-1. The victories came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 64.0 points over those games. As for Fairland,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 3-5.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ming matchups. Ironton will venture away from home to square off against Gallia Academy at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Fairland, they will head out to face off against Dawson-Bryant at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. The Hornets will aim to continue their three-game streak of scoring more points each game than the last.
